Rich in cattle, coal and oil, the history of Strawn  is unique and varied, and we are immensely proud of the heritage handed to us by our forefathers. We work very hard to preserve it. Just one look at some of the beautiful
homes in our community and you'll see that statement is not made lightly.

At the same time, Strawn is a proud, thriving community embracing all that is good about small town life today.  An exemplary school system,  friendly people and quality businesses make ours a community dedicated to our future.

Located close enough for some and far away enough for others, Strawn is situated exactly midway between Abilene and Fort Worth,  just off Interstate 20. (See map
here)  Nestled in the beautiful southern quadrant of the Palo Pinto Mountains and only a few miles south of Possum Kingdom Lake, we are in the center of a recreational and hunting mecca. Surrounded by cattle and cutting horse ranches and little else, our town offers a quiet and peaceful respite from busy city life .
